I work a full time job where more than 99% of my income comes from. Should I still use Self-Employed since I had a very small income through Amway?

If you don't have any expenses to claim against the Amway income, then you can use TurboTax Deluxe to add your small amount of business income and still file your regular wages.  

If you have expenses, then you would still need TurboTax Self-Employed.  But, if its a very small amount of expenses, then it may not be worth upgrading to the Self-Employed to claim them.
